wazzup test task: backend

Simple Notes application with user registration and notes sharing.

Requirements

  • Node.js >=14 (LTS)
  • PostgreSQL
  • Redis

Installation and Running

Create Postgres db. Create .env file in project's root. See .env.sample for details.

  1. npm run initdb - Initialize DB migrations and seeds.
  2. npm start - starting backend in dev mode.

Pros and Cons

  • no framework in use (like Nest), only 'low-level' express
  • no passportjs auth, low-level token manipulation (use of JWT)
  • no high-level ORM and no low-level API's to DB calling raw queries. Instead, used query builder
  • so created kind of 'models' in services for dealing with DB
  • MVC-simplified pattern
  • no email confirmation, user delete, password change for simplicity (and not mandatory as of task description)
  • typescript
  • express middleware and route handlers use promises instead callbacks
  • No SSL
  • Redis connection is unprotected
  • Postgres connection is unprotected
  • JWT claims are not used for simplicity; redis is for blacklisted tokens
  • Redis is not used for saving shared link info
